Arunachal an inalienable part of India, says MEA in rebuff to Chinese claims

The statement reiterated the Indian position that the people of Arunachal Pradesh will continue to benefit from development initiatives and infrastructure projects undertaken by the Indian government.

The Ministry of External Affairs (MEA) in a terse statement on Tuesday dismissed Chinese assertions on Arunachal Pradesh as "absurd claims." This statement comes close on the heels of the Chinese military reiterating its claim over the northeastern state.

 

Reacting to media queries on the comments by a Chinese Defence Ministry spokesperson, MEA spokesperson Randhir Jaiswal asserted that Arunachal Pradesh "was, is and will always be" an integral part of India. He emphasized that "repeating baseless arguments" does not validate China's stance.

Earlier, Chinese state media had reported comments by Senior Colonel Zhang Xiaogang, spokesperson for the Chinese Defence Ministry, claiming the southern part of Tibet as Chinese territory.

 

Notably, China refers to Tibet as Xizang. 

 

Colonel Zhang went on to state that Beijing "never acknowledges and firmly opposes" the "so-called Arunachal Pradesh illegally established by India."

 

India has consistently contested China's territorial claims over Arunachal Pradesh, maintaining that the state is an inseparable part of the nation. New Delhi has also firmly rejected China's attempts to rename the region.
